Whats The Easiest Lift

96 F150 LB/EXTCAB/4X4/5.8L- Just seeing whats out there as far as lifts go. Priced a few and they are high. Looking for a more cost effective way to lift the old beats-2"-4", nothing bigger.

I had the 2 inch coil spacers on mine before the 6 inch lift.
You can get them here at Jeff Broncos graveyard or ebay.
http://broncograveyard.com/bronco/c-179
You will need the adjustable alignment bushings also and then get a alignment.
